Output 58f3ddea724a951eb0c173f1aa07c8e3fccd00b9b6daed41a8565e6a34984318:4

value
71798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85dc28beaeada6d6eef4b87039eac20a5834e1f6 OP_EQUAL
address
3DtoXz1h31y1ix1tNH2hdn7aaeUg4mWCBk
transaction
58f3ddea724a951eb0c173f1aa07c8e3fccd00b9b6daed41a8565e6a34984318
spent
true